fix(modal): next arrow clears metadata panel + arrows work in empty tag input
Image viewer (#609): - The next (▶) arrow was offset from the viewport edge (right:16px) so it floated over the 320px metadata side panel. Offset it off a shared --fc-side-w var so it sits at the image's right edge instead; full-width again below 900px when the panel stacks under the image. - Arrow nav was fully disabled whenever a text field was focused. Now it yields to the caret ONLY when the field has text; an empty tag-entry field still navigates ←/→. Extracted to utils/textEntry.js (arrowNavAllowed). ESC behaviour unchanged (already closes the modal, overlay-aware). Test: arrowNavAllowed — empty/non-text → navigate, text present → don't.
